We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 12GB VRAM TITAN X Pascal and 48GB VRAM TITAN Ada to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.

Main Differences

NVIDIA TITAN X Pascal 's Advantages
Lower TDP (250W vs 800W)
NVIDIA TITAN Ada 's Advantages
Boost Clock has increased by 65% (2520MHz vs 1531MHz)
More VRAM (48GB vs 12G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(1.15TB/s vs 480.4GB/s)
14848 additional rendering cores
